You are on page 1of 6

KURIKULUM SMK “8”, KOTA “C”

SILABUS
NAMA SEKOLAH : .................................
MATA PELAJARAN : Perencanaan Web Lanjut
KELAS/SEMESTER :
STANDAR KOMPETENSI : Membuat halaman web dinamis tingkat dasar
KODE KOMPETENSI : TIK.PR04.002.01
ALOKASI WAKTU : 128 X 45 Menit

ALOKASI WAKTU
KOMPETENSI MATERI
KEGIATAN PEMBELAJARAN INDIKATOR PENILAIAN TM PS PI SUMBER
DASAR PEMBELAJARAN
BELAJAR
1. Mempersiapkan  Program aplikasi  Menyediakn software  Lingkungan Pengamatan 4 4(8)  Buku
lingkungan teknis pengembangan web pengembangan web pengembangan Tes tertulis Pemrogram
dan server dan software Hasil an PHP
 Menyediakan server web yang  Komputer
server tersedia
 Akses server jaringan dapat diakses
dan dapat diakses  Jobsheet
 Mengakses server web sesuai  Modul
 Direktori virtual dengan kebijaksanaan dan  Akses atau server
jaringan sesuai
prosedur organisasi
dengan
 Menentukan direktori virtual untuk kebijaksanaan
menyimpan file-file web dan prosedur
organisasi
 Direktori virtual
dibuat dan
disimpan dalam
direktori yang
tepat untuk akses
server

PROGRAM KEAHLIAN : SILABUS - PERENCANAAN WEB LANJUT


REKAYASA PERANGKAT LUNAK Halaman 1 dari 6
KURIKULUM SMK “8”, KOTA “C”

KOMPETENSI MATERI ALOKASI WAKTU


KEGIATAN PEMBELAJARAN INDIKATOR
DASAR PEMBELAJARAN PENILAIAN TM PS PI SUMBER

2. Membuat  Tata penulisan WEB  Membuat halaman dan Menyimpan  Halaman dibuat  Pengamatan 8 8(16)  BELAJAR
Buku
halaman dinamis ekstensi ekstensi yang tepat dan disimpan  Tes tertulis Pemrogram
 Akses WEB an PHP
kemudian dengan ekstensi
 Tag- tag HTML yang tepat  Komputer
 Menyimpan ke dalam direktori/  Jobsheet
 Akses file melalui folder yang tepat kemudian disimpan
http://localhost, alamat ke dalam direktori/  Modul
IP lokal, atau URL  Menambahkan kode diantara tag folder yang tepat
lengkap pembatas
 Kode ditambahkan
 Penempatan Break dan indent diantara tag
yang tepat pada baris Kode ke pembatas
dalam baris yang memudahkan
pembacaan  Break dan indent
yang tepat pada
 Menambahkan Tag HTML yang baris Kode ke
digunakan pada format halaman dalam baris yang
dan konten sesuai dengan memudahkan
kebutuhan pembacaan
 Tag HTML
 Menyimpan halaman disimpan digunakan pada
dalam direktori yang tepat format halaman
dan konten
 Akses file melalui http://localhost,
ditambahkan
alamat IP lokal, atau URL lengkap
sesuai dengan
 Modifikasi dibuat sesuai kebutuhan kebutuhan
 Halaman disimpan
dalam direktori
yang tepat
 Akses file melalui
http://localhost,
alamat IP lokal,
atau URL lengkap
o Mo
difikasi dibuat
sesuai kebutuhan

PROGRAM KEAHLIAN : SILABUS - PERENCANAAN WEB LANJUT


REKAYASA PERANGKAT LUNAK Halaman 2 dari 6
KURIKULUM SMK “8”, KOTA “C”

KOMPETENSI MATERI ALOKASI WAKTU


KEGIATAN PEMBELAJARAN INDIKATOR
DASAR PEMBELAJARAN PENILAIAN TM PS PI SUMBER
3. Menambahkan  Variabel-variabel dan  Menggunakan dan  Variabel-variabel  Uji coba 8 8(16)  BELAJAR
Buku
fungsi-fungsi array menurut Mendeklarasikan Variabel-variabel dan array Program Pemrogram
pada halaman persyaratan dan array menurut persyaratan digunakan dan Sederhana an PHP
dinamis  Nilai variabel, string,  Menetapkan Nilai variabel, string, dideklarasikan  Komputer
dan konstanta. dan konstanta. menurut  Jobsheet
 Control Structure  Menggunakan fungsi-fungsi persyaratan  Modul
internal yang digunakan pada  Nilai variabel,
halaman web string, dan
 Menggunakan Control Structure konstanta
( seperti statement If, While, for, ditetapkan.
switch ) sesuai kebutuhan  Fungsi-fungsi
 Membuat aplikasi sederhana internal digunakan
dengan menggunakan control pada halaman web
stucture
 Control Structure
( seperti statement
If, While, for,
switch ) digunakan
sesuai kebutuhan

4. Menguji dan  Pengujian dan  Menyimpan halaman pada server  Halaman disimpan  Hasil program 4 8(16)  Buku
mengakhiri Housting di lokasi yang tepat pada server di  Tes tertulis Pemrogram
halaman dinamis  Menampilkan/menguji halaman lokasi yang tepat. an PHP
dinamis ditampilkan pada browser  Halaman dinamis  Komputer
 Membuat fungsi format dan ditampilkan pa-da  Jobsheet
dinamis secara keseluruhan sesuai browser dan diuji  Modul
dengan kebutuham bisnis dan  Fungsi format dan
pelanggan dinamis secara
 Mengakhiri halaman pelanggan keseluruhan dibuat
sesuai memenuhi persyaratan sesuai dengan
bisnis kebutuham bisnis
 Merangkai aplikasi halaman per dan pelanggan
halaman sesuai permintaan  Halaman
pelanggan pelanggan diakhiri
sesuai memenuhi
persyaratan bisnis

NAMA SEKOLAH : .................................

PROGRAM KEAHLIAN : SILABUS - PERENCANAAN WEB LANJUT


REKAYASA PERANGKAT LUNAK Halaman 3 dari 6
KURIKULUM SMK “8”, KOTA “C”

MATA PELAJARAN : Perencanaan Web Lanjut


KELAS/SEMESTER :
STANDAR KOMPETENSI : Membuat halaman web dinamis tingkat lanjut
KODE KOMPETENSI : TIK.PR04.003.01
ALOKASI WAKTU : 128 X 45 Menit

ALOKASI WAKTU
KOMPETENSI MATERI
KEGIATAN PEMBELAJARAN INDIKATOR PENILAIAN TM PS PI SUMBER
DASAR PEMBELAJARAN
BELAJAR
1. Memahami  Konsep dan  Mengkoneksikan Internet untuk  Standar Hasil Program 4 4(8)  Buku Macro-
Teknologi pembelajaran WEB dinamis pemrograman yang Tes tertuli media
pemrograman
pengembangan  Menjelaskan standar pemrograman penting dari internet Pengamatan Dream-
Web dinamis
WEB yang penting dari internet dapat dapat dijelaskan weaver
 Mengidentifikasi konten konten  Modul design
WEB WEB
 Mengamati berbagai aplikasi web  Buku PHP
sebagai contoh di internet  Komputer
 Jobsheet
2. Mempersiapkan  Software aplikasi  Mengidentifikasi perlengkapan  Perlengkapan  Web Aplikasi 4 8(16)  Buku Macro
membuat aplikasi pengembangan software teks editor dan browser software teks editor E learning media Dream
WEB sesuai dengan kebutuhan dan browser sesuai  Web browser weaver
dengan kebutuhan untuk aplikasi  Modul design
 Desai Lay out dan  Mengoperasikan software sesuai  Pengamatan WEB
Scripting dengan standar operasi aplikasi diidentifikasi
 Tanya jawab  Buku PHP
 Sumber daya server  Menentukan sumber data yang  Software
 Komputer
dibutuhkan sudah ketentuan dioperasikan sesuai
 Jobsheet
dimana letaknya dan bagaimana dengan standar
mengaksesnya. operasi aplikasi

 Menyiapkan sketsa disain untuk  Sumber data yang


web yang akan dibuat dibutuhkan sudah
ditentukan dimana
 Menyiapkan desain interface/ letaknya dan
menu-menu bagaimana
mengaksesnya.

PROGRAM KEAHLIAN : SILABUS - PERENCANAAN WEB LANJUT


REKAYASA PERANGKAT LUNAK Halaman 4 dari 6
KURIKULUM SMK “8”, KOTA “C”

KOMPETENSI MATERI ALOKASI WAKTU


KEGIATAN PEMBELAJARAN INDIKATOR
DASAR PEMBELAJARAN PENILAIAN TM PS PI SUMBER
BELAJAR
 Software aplikasi  Menentukan bagian-bagian yang  Sketsa disain untuk
pengembangan akan dibuat menjadi program script web yang akan
WEB dan modul-modul dibuat sudah
 Desai Lay out dan  Menentukan server yang akan disiapkan
Scripting digunakan untuk web, dimana  Desain interface/
 Sumber daya server script dijalankan, dan patform menu-menu sudah
komputer apa yang akan disiapkan
digunakan sudah  Ditentukan bagian-
 Mendesain Sketsa untuk web bagian yang akan
 Mendesain interface/ menu-menu dibuat menjadi
program script dan
modul-modul
 Server yang akan
digunakan untuk
web, dimana script
dijalankan, dan
patform komputer
apa yang akan
digunakan sudah
ditentukan

    Kompilasi 8 16(32) 8(32)  Buku


3. Membuat web File-file HTML Membuat coding file-file HTML File-file HTML dibuat
program Macromedi
 Coding dan Scripting  Membangun kode program script dengan cara coding
menggunakan  Pengamatan a
bahasa script  Pengujian script dan dibangun  Kode program script  Tes tulis Dreamwea
desain WEB  Menguji coba code program script dibangun dan diuji ver
yang dibangun beserta modul-modul beserta modul-modul
yang digunakan yang digunakan

 Menampilkan Web yang dibuat  Web yang dibuat


dilayar sesuai dengan rancangan tampil dilayar sesuai
dengan rancangan
 Mendemonstrasikan tujuan dari
pengiriman konten Web yang terdiri  Tujuan dari
dari file program pengiriman konten
Web yang terdiri dari
file program
didemonstrasikan

PROGRAM KEAHLIAN : SILABUS - PERENCANAAN WEB LANJUT


REKAYASA PERANGKAT LUNAK Halaman 5 dari 6
KURIKULUM SMK “8”, KOTA “C”

KOMPETENSI MATERI ALOKASI WAKTU


KEGIATAN PEMBELAJARAN INDIKATOR
DASAR PEMBELAJARAN PENILAIAN TM PS PI SUMBER

 Mendemonstrasikan  Keuntungan/kerugian  BELAJAR


Buku
keuntungan/kerugian pemrosesan pemrosesan client- Macromedi
client-side side a
didemonstrasikan Dreamwea
ver

4. Mengenali isu-isu  Keamanan  Mengaplikasikan proteksi Web, agar  Proteksi Web, agar  Kompilasi 4 8(16)  Buku
keamanan Web WEB/WEB Security web hanya dapat diakses oleh yang web hanya dapat program Macromedi
berhak. diakses oleh yang  Pengamatan a
 Memahami Sekuritas web berhak diaplikasikan.  Tes tulis Dreamwea
ver
 Membuat scrip sekuritas web  Isu-isu keamanan  Modul
pada pemroses-an design
client side WEB
 Mengidentifikasi Isu-isu keamanan diidentifikasi.  Buku PHP
pada pemroses-an client side.  Komputer
 Jobsheet
Keterangan

TM : Tatap Muka
PS : Praktek di Sekolah (2 jam praktik di sekolah setara dengan 1 jam tatap muka)
PI : Praktek di Industri (4 jam praktik di Du/ Di setara dengan 1 jam tatap muka)

PROGRAM KEAHLIAN : SILABUS - PERENCANAAN WEB LANJUT


REKAYASA PERANGKAT LUNAK Halaman 6 dari 6

You might also like